Hi all,

I'm trying to build current mainline git with gcc version 4.4.1 as a 
cross compiler and I'm getting the following:


   CC      arch/powerpc/kernel/ptrace.o
{standard input}: Assembler messages:
{standard input}:1619: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:2074: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:2742: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:2855: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:2943: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:4699: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:4794: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:4915: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:4985: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
{standard input}:5087: Error: junk at end of line: `1'
make[2]: *** [arch/powerpc/kernel/ptrace.o] Error 1
make[1]: *** [arch/powerpc/kernel] Error 2
make: *** [sub-make] Error 2


Any ideas on how to deal with this?  Is this a code error or a compiler 
error?
